How To Fix FMCA_BRF050 - Drag and drop is only possible in the change mode


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: FMCA_BRF - FMCA -> BRF Interface

  • Message number: 050

  • Message text: Drag and drop is only possible in the change mode

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message FMCA_BRF050 - Drag and drop is only possible in the change mode ?

    The SAP error message FMCA_BRF050 ("Drag and drop is only possible in the change mode") typically occurs in the context of the Business Rule Framework (BRF) when a user attempts to use drag-and-drop functionality in a mode that does not allow for changes, such as display mode.

    Cause:

    The error is triggered because the user is trying to perform an action (like dragging and dropping elements) that is only permitted when the system is in change mode. In display mode, the system restricts modifications to ensure data integrity and prevent unintended changes.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you should switch to change mode. Here’s how you can do that:

    1. Switch to Change Mode:

      • Look for a button or option labeled "Change" or "Edit" in the user interface.
      • Click on it to enter change mode.
    2. Perform the Drag and Drop Action:

      • Once in change mode, try performing the drag-and-drop action again.
    3. Save Changes:

      • After making the necessary changes, ensure you save your work to avoid losing any modifications.

    Related Information:

    • User Permissions: Ensure that you have the necessary permissions to switch to change mode. If you do not have the required authorizations, you may need to contact your system administrator.
    • BRF Configuration: Familiarize yourself with the BRF configuration and how to navigate its interface, as this will help you avoid similar issues in the future.
    •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for more detailed guidance on using the BRF and its functionalities.

    If you continue to experience issues after switching to change mode, consider checking for any system updates or patches that may address bugs related to the BRF interface.
